The instructions below show you how to use the EndNote Online Cite-While-You-Write toolbar to insert citations into a Microsoft Word 2007 document.ġ) Place the cursor where you would like the in-text citation to be placed in the documentĢ) In Microsoft Word 2007, click on the EndNote Online tab and then click on the Find Citations iconģ) Insert a search term (a word or name that appears somewhere in the EndNote Online reference you are looking for) and click FindĤ) Highlight the citation you want to place in the document and click Insertĥ) You should now see an in-text citation as well as a corresponding reference placed at the bottom of the pageĦ) If your paper does not show the word "References" (or whatever your selected style requires as the label for the reference section) at the top of your end-of-text bibliography, then go to the EndNote Online toolbar, and click on the small arrow in the bottom right corner of the Bibliography box.ħ) Click on the Layout tab.
